Communications Writer and Editor

Salem Academy and College is looking for a Communications Writer & Editor to develop compelling content through engaging messaging and storytelling techniques that connects with a vast, multicultural audience and influential stakeholder groups including prospective students, parents, alumni, and donors. The Communications Writer & Editor develops engaging content for marketing and communications materials, writes and edits reports, news releases and feature articles, website content, presentations, video scripts, and other forms of internal and external materials. The ideal candidate will have advanced written communication skills, extensive knowledge of Associated Press (AP) writing and editing, and experience writing editorial copy and providing support for public relations initiatives and objectives. The ideal candidate will have knowledge of multiple media formats and the ability to write for different communications platforms including executive level messaging. The Communications Writer & Editor will support new branding initiatives and help develop a unified voice among Salem’s various communications channels.

The Communications Writer & Editor must have strong interpersonal communication skills and enthusiasm to work with different internal groups, understand their communications and marketing needs, and translate messaging into audience friendly materials to meet marketing and communications goals and objectives. The Communications Writer & Editor will have a deep understanding of Salem’s various target audiences and stakeholders and how to adapt writing style based on audience preferences and the platforms used to communicate. The successful candidate reports to the Executive Director of Marketing and Communications and assists in developing comprehensive communications plans and multimedia campaigns.

The Communications Writer & Editor helps to position Salem as one of the most esteemed liberal arts colleges for women and as the nation’s only college dedicated to elevating and expanding women’s roles in health leadership. The writer and editor also supports communications and marketing efforts for Salem Academy, a boarding and day school exclusive for girls grades 9-12. Crucial to this role, the ideal candidate will develop, manage, and maintain the agency’s content calendar by using an online management tool.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Serve as the primary writer and editor for Salem Academy and College
  • Proactively create, develop, and manage the institution’s content calendar using an online tool
  • Write, create, design, distribute, and manage newsletters
  • Oversee the production of various annual reports by writing content, collaborating with our photographer for quality images, and collaborating with a graphic designer for design
  • Write copy, develop content, and help manage websites
  • Develop strategic messaging for branding campaigns
  • Write copy and messaging for email marketing campaigns
  • Collaborate with the social media manager to synergize content calendars and to ensure a unified voice across platforms
  • Collaborate with in-house videographer to write compelling scripts for short and long form videos
  • Write and distribute news releases and assist with various media relations efforts
  • Collaborate with enrollment marketing and other departments to update admissions materials for student recruitment and alumni outreach
  • Help to develop various marketing and communications plans and campaigns
  • Assist in executive leadership communications, reviewing presentations, and developing talking points for speeches

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in journalism, communications, public relations, marketing, or related field
  • Five years of experience in journalism, communications, public relations, marketing, or related field
  • Thorough working knowledge of Associated Press (AP) writing and editing
  • Employ near-perfect proofreading review of documents and materials
  • Ability to apply discretion and judgment in evaluating implications of information release to internal and external audiences
  • Superb writing, editing, content, and message development skills
  • Strong interpersonal skills to collaborate with individuals in varying positions
  • Collaborative mindset working on a team to achieve organizational goals
  • Ability to take initiative to outline new processes and innovative tools to support marketing and communications goals
  • Experience in publication and editorial processes and managing complex editorial and publication projects
  • Experience working in higher education or in the educational field preferred
  • Graphic design skills a plus
